Won't give tickets to Muslims as they don't believe in us: BJP leader KS Eshwarappa

India Blooms News Service | @indiablooms | 02 Apr 2019, 09:44 am

Bangalore, Apr 2 (IBNS):  Senior BJP leader in Karnataka KS Eshwarappa has triggered a controversy as he said that his party will not give tickets to Muslims  as they do not believe in the religious outfit.

He said tickets will be given to the Muslim community once they start believing in the BJP.

“Congress uses you only as a vote bank and doesn’t give you tickets. We won’t give Muslims tickets because you don’t believe in us. Believe us and we’ll give you tickets and other things,” KS Eshwarappa was quoted as saying by the Hindustan Times.

He made the remarks while he was addressing the members of Kuruba and minority communities.

He was addressing the community in Karnataka’s Koppal area.

The BJP leader made the remark just days before the first phase of voting for the Lok Sabha polls will be held.

Karnataka will vote in two phases on Apr 18 and Apr 23.

Counting of votes will take place on May 23.
